Review of Testosterone



Testosterone, an essential hormone in the human body, plays an important function in different physical processes, consisting of muscular tissue growth, bone thickness, and overall physical performance. Primarily created in the testes in males and in smaller sized quantities in the ovaries and adrenal glands in women, testosterone is identified as an androgen, a type of steroid hormonal agent. Its synthesis is regulated by a comments loophole including the hypothalamus, pituitary gland, and the gonads.


The value of testosterone prolongs past reproductive health; it influences state of mind, power levels, and cognitive features. Optimum testosterone levels are necessary for maintaining a healthy sex drive, advertising fat distribution, and supporting muscle mass strength. As individuals age, testosterone degrees normally decline, commonly leading to different wellness concerns, including decreased physical efficiency, fatigue, and decreased bone density.


Recognizing testosterone's multifaceted function in the body is vital for acknowledging its influence on total health and performance. Clinicians commonly assess testosterone levels in individuals experiencing signs linked with reduced testosterone, referred to as hypogonadism. Preserving balanced testosterone degrees is critical for promoting well-being and enhancing physical abilities across various life phases.


Influence On Muscular Tissue Development



A substantial correlation exists between testosterone levels and muscle mass development, highlighting the hormonal agent's essential role in promoting anabolic processes within the body. Testosterone helps with protein synthesis, which is important for muscular tissue hypertrophy. Elevated testosterone levels improve the body's capability to construct and repair muscle tissue adhering to resistance training, a vital part of muscle mass growth.


Study indicates that people with greater testosterone levels usually exhibit increased muscular tissue mass and stamina compared to those with reduced degrees. This relationship is particularly noticeable in males, as they generally have higher testosterone concentrations than ladies. Testosterone's influence expands beyond straight muscle-building impacts; it also regulates factors such as satellite cell task, which is important for muscular tissue regeneration and development.

An increase in testosterone can also result in enhanced healing times, enabling even more intense and regular training sessions. On the other hand, reduced testosterone levels can impede muscle mass advancement and add to muscle mass wasting, a condition known as sarcopenia, especially in older adults. In general, maintaining optimal testosterone levels is essential for optimizing muscular tissue development, highlighting the hormone's importance in both athletic efficiency and basic health and wellness.


Impacts on Physical Performance



Optimal testosterone degrees are essential for boosting total physical efficiency, influencing various athletic capabilities. Testosterone, a vital anabolic hormonal agent, plays a significant role in energy metabolism, muscle mass strength, and endurance. Greater testosterone levels are connected with improved efficiency in strength-based activities, such as weightlifting and sprinting, along with in endurance sporting activities, where stamina and recuperation are critical.

Aspects Affecting Testosterone Levels



Countless elements can affect testosterone levels, impacting not only hormone balance yet likewise athletic efficiency. Age is a considerable factor, as testosterone degrees typically peak in early adulthood and decline with advancing age. is 1 ml of testosterone a week enough. Way of living selections also play an important function; as an example, routine exercise, especially resistance training, has actually been shown to raise testosterone degrees, while inactive habits can bring about declines




Nutritional habits are equally influential. Nutrient shortages, particularly in zinc and vitamin D, have been connected to reduced testosterone degrees. Additionally, body composition is essential; people with greater body fat percents usually experience reduced testosterone degrees due to the conversion of testosterone to estrogen in fat.


Emotional factors, consisting of stress and sleep quality, can not be forgotten, as chronic stress raises cortisol degrees, adversely influencing testosterone production. Understanding these impacts is vital for developing detailed approaches to enhance testosterone degrees in adults.
